Unveiling 'The Masked Singer' Season 10 Eliminations: Discovering the Identities of Tiki & Husky
Unleashing
the excitement of unmasking season, The Masked Singer's 10th season kicked off
on September 27, revealing Rubber Ducky as the inaugural elimination. Diver
followed suit the next week, and Pickle bid farewell during the tribute to
Elton John on October 18. The saga continued with Harry Potter Night, where
Hawk's performance fell short, leading to his elimination. The recent weeks
brought forth captivating reveals of S'More, Cuddle Monster, Hibiscus, Tiki,
and Husky.
Before the
official Season 10 premiere, The Masked Singer treated fans to a special
kickoff episode featuring a standout performance by Anonymouse. The night
concluded with the revelation of Anonymouse's identity, marking a memorable
moment in the show's history.

Sebastian Bach Takes Off the Tiki Mask:
In a
dramatic "I Wanna Rock" Night, former Skid Row band member Sebastian
Bach emerged as Tiki on the December 6 episode. Facing off against the Sea
Queen in a Battle Royale, Tiki's true identity was revealed, marking a pivotal
moment in the season.
Ginuwine Sheds the Husky Persona:
Also
unmasked during "I Wanna Rock" Night, R&B sensation Ginuwine
delivered a remarkable rendition of Bon Jovi's "Always." In an
exclusive interview with Hollywood Life, Ginuwine shared his initial hesitation
about joining the show but ultimately embraced the opportunity to step out of
his comfort zone.
S'More's Sweet Melody Ends for Ashley Parker Angel:
Disco Night
saw O-Town singer Ashley Parker Angel unmasked as S'More on November 29.
Despite a lively performance of "That's the Way (I Like It)" by KC
and the Sunshine Band, Ashley was eliminated, with Jenny McCarthy being the
lone panelist to correctly guess his identity.
Metta World Peace's Cuddle Monster Farewell:
NBA veteran
Metta World Peace donned the Cuddle Monster costume for Trolls Night but faced
challenges due to its weight. In an exclusive interview, Metta shared insights
into the "great experience" on the show, highlighting the physical
demands of performing in the elaborate costume.
Luann de Lesseps Blooms as Hibiscus:
Radiant as
the Hibiscus, Real Housewives of New York alum Luann de Lesseps graced the
stage during One Hit Wonders Night. In an exclusive interview, Luann expressed
excitement about stepping out of her comfort zone, with Jenny McCarthy
correctly guessing her identity.
Tyler Posey's Harry Potter Night Revelation:
On Harry
Potter Night, Teen Wolf alum Tyler Posey unmasked as Hawk. Reflecting on his
journey, Tyler spoke exclusively with HollywoodLife, emphasizing his
determination to give his all despite the challenges posed by the massive Hawk
costume.
Billie Jean King's Royal Exit:
During the
Elton John celebration, tennis legend Billie Jean King revealed herself as the
Royal Hen. Performing "Philadelphia Freedom," a song written about
her, Billie faced off against Hawk but was eliminated on October 18, with Ken
Jeong correctly identifying her.
Michael Rapaport's 2000s Night Unmasking:
Comedian
Michael Rapaport became Pickle during 2000s Night, delivering a spirited
performance of Weezer's "Beverly Hills." In an interview, Michael
expressed pride in remaining unidentified until the reveal and expressed
interest in returning to The Masked Singer as a guest panelist.
Tom Sandoval's Dive into Unmasking:
Vanderpump
Rules star Tom Sandoval revealed himself as Diver on October 4. Performing
"I Ain't Worried" by OneRepublic, Tom addressed his challenging year
and cheating scandal, emphasizing his desire to showcase his talent on the
show.
Anthony Anderson's Quack Unveiled:
Black-ish
alum Anthony Anderson surprised as Rubber Ducky in the Season 10 premiere,
performing "Come On Eileen." Ken Jeong correctly guessed Anthony's
identity, showcasing the panel's final accurate prediction before the
unmasking.
Demi Lovato's Anonymouse Debut:
In the
special kickoff episode, Demi Lovato donned the Anonymouse costume and
delivered a stunning rendition of Heart's "What About Love." While
initially mistaken for Miley Cyrus or Christina Aguilera, Nicole Scherzinger
eventually identified Demi, who expressed her joy at participating in the show.
